When is a Tooth Extraction Necessary?

Tooth extraction is often considered a last resort, but there are situations where it becomes the best option for your oral health:

  • Severe Decay or Damage: When a tooth is too decayed or damaged to be restored with a filling, crown, or other treatment, extraction may be necessary to prevent further complications.

  • Impacted Wisdom Teeth: Wisdom teeth that are impacted or partially erupted can cause pain, crowding, or infection. Removing them can prevent these issues and protect surrounding teeth.

  • Overcrowding: In cases where there isn’t enough room in your mouth for all of your teeth to align properly, extraction can create space for orthodontic treatments like braces.

  • Infection or Risk of Infection: If an infection in a tooth is severe and doesn’t respond to root canal therapy, extraction may be necessary to prevent the infection from spreading.

Recovery After Extraction

Healing from a tooth extraction typically takes a few days to a week. To ensure a smooth recovery, follow these guidelines:

    • Rest and Recovery: Take it easy for the first 24 hours after the extraction, avoiding strenuous activity.

 

    • Manage Discomfort: Use over-the-counter pain relievers as directed by your dentist, and apply ice packs to reduce swelling.

 

    • Eat Soft Foods: Stick to soft, cool foods like yogurt, applesauce, and mashed potatoes until the extraction site has healed.

 

    • Avoid Straws and Smoking: The suction can dislodge the blood clot that forms in the extraction site, leading to complications.
